Understanding Return-to-Player Rates and Game Fairness

Understanding Return-to-Player rates and game fairness begins with reading the RTP percentage listed in each game’s paytable, as this figure represents the theoretical long-term payout over millions of spins. A higher RTP, typically above 96%, reduces the house edge, but it never guarantees short-term results. To verify fairness, check for a certified random number generator and look for game-specific audit seals or hash verification tools that allow you to confirm each round’s outcome independently. Avoid games with undisclosed RTP values or vague volatility descriptions, as transparency is your primary safeguard.

Online casino

  • Always cross-reference the listed RTP with the provider’s official documentation.
  • Use provably fair games that let you verify each result’s seed and nonce.
  • Compare volatility alongside RTP to match your bankroll to the expected payout frequency.

Step-by-Step Account Creation and Identity Verification

Begin by locating the “Sign Up” or “Join Now” button, then complete the form with your legal name, date of birth, and active email address. Next, choose a unique username and a strong password, opting for multi-factor authentication if offered. After submitting, you’ll receive a confirmation email—click the verification link to activate your account. Following login, proceed to the cashier or “KYC” section to upload clear, unexpired documents: a government-issued ID (passport or driver’s license) and a recent utility bill or bank statement matching your name and address. For deposits, you may also need a photo of the payment card (showing only the last four digits) or a bank account screenshot. The casino typically reviews these files within 24–72 hours, sending an approval notification once your identity is confirmed. Only after this step can you deposit and place your first real-money wager.

Step-by-step account creation and identity verification ensures your funds and winnings remain protected under your own name.

Why do I need to verify my identity before a real-money wager? Casinos require proof of identity to prevent fraud and money laundering, confirming you are of legal age and that your withdrawal matches your registration details.

Choosing the Right Payment Method for Fast Deposits and Withdrawals

Selecting the right payment method directly dictates how quickly your funds move before and after play. E-wallets like Skrill or Neteller typically offer the fastest withdrawals, often processing within hours, while credit cards and bank transfers can take several business days for the return trip. For deposits, instant credit is common across all options, but the real bottleneck appears when cashing out, so prioritize methods with swift payout clearance. However, a method’s speed can vary based on your specific bank’s processing windows, making it wise to check historical withdrawal times for that option. To balance convenience and immediacy, pair a debit card for deposits with an e-wallet for fast withdrawal processing times, ensuring you avoid unnecessary delays at the cashier.

Decoding Wagering Requirements—What 35x or 50x Actually Means

When you see a bonus with a 35x or 50x wagering requirement, that number tells you exactly how many times you must bet the bonus amount (or bonus plus deposit) before you can withdraw winnings. A 35x requirement on a $100 bonus means you need to wager $3,500 total. A 50x jumps that to $5,000—a massive difference for the same initial reward. Always check whether the requirement applies to the bonus only or the bonus plus deposit, as that changes the math significantly. This is where **bonus fine-print pitfalls** hide, so calculate the true playthrough before claiming.

Q: Does a 50x wagering requirement mean I can just bet $100 fifty times?
A: Not exactly—if it’s 50x the bonus plus deposit, on $100 each, you’d need to wager $10,000 total, not just $5,000, so always read the exact wording.

Loyalty Programs and Cashback Offers: How to Extract Real Value

Loyalty programs and cashback offers unlock value only when you calculate their true conversion rate. Prioritize programs that convert points to cash at a fixed ratio—like 100 points = $1—rather than tiered systems that require escalating playthrough thresholds. For cashback, track whether it’s credited as real money or bonus funds, since the latter often carries a 10x wagering requirement that erodes 90% of its nominal worth. Extracting real value demands comparing effective cashback percentages after applying turnover conditions. Also, verify whether loyalty points expire after 30 days of inactivity and whether cashback caps reset weekly or monthly. A table clarifies the difference:

Aspect Loyalty Points Cashback
Redemption Flexible, but often tier-gated Automatic, percentage-based
Wagering impact Points earn via wagers, but redemption may be free Cashback often requires 1x–5x play
Expiry risk High with inactive periods Low, usually monthly reset

Only join cashback schemes with no maximum cap on losses returned, and only grind loyalty tiers if the incremental reward—like a free wager or bonus credit—exceeds the expected loss from the extra play required to reach it.

Bankroll Management Strategies That Keep You Playing Longer

In online casino play, your session length hinges entirely on how you segment your deposit, not on streaks. A core strategy is dividing your bankroll into smaller, session-specific units; never gamble more than 1-2% of your total balance on a single spin or hand, ensuring bad beats cannot wipe you out. Set a hard loss limit before logging in, and equally important, a profit target—cashing out 30% of any win solidifies gains. By sticking to flat betting and lowering stakes when variance spikes, you convert luck into lasting entertainment. Ultimately, smart bankroll management is the only edge that guarantees longer playing time, protecting you from the casino’s mathematical house advantage over the long run.

Comparing Instant-Play Platforms vs. Native iOS and Android Applications

When comparing instant-play platforms versus native iOS and Android applications for online casino gaming, the core trade-off is accessibility against performance. Browser-based instant-play eliminates downloads, letting you jump into a session directly from Safari or Chrome, which suits low-storage devices or quick spins. Native apps, however, deliver smoother animations and lower latency, crucial for live dealer tables where every second counts. Instant-play platforms often sacrifice advanced haptic feedback and background push notifications that native builds leverage for bonuses. Battery drain also differs: browsers typically consume more power due to rendering overhead, while optimized native code runs leaner. For login persistence, native apps retain credentials securely via keychain, whereas instant-play relies on cookies, which may expire mid-session. Ultimately, choose native for uninterrupted, feature-rich play; instant-play for zero-friction testing.

  • Native apps offer offline access to certain game assets, while instant-play requires a stable connection.
  • Instant-play avoids device storage fragmentation, especially on older iPhones or Androids.
  • Native builds integrate Face ID or fingerprint authentication, adding a security layer instant-play lacks.
  • Browser platforms update universally without app-store approval delays, but native patches are more frequent post-release.
